【phpWeb产品模块放大镜插件】是一种在网页上实现产品细节查看的增强工具,尤其适用于电子商务网站。这个插件允许用户通过鼠标悬停或点击产品图片,来查看图片的放大效果,从而提供更清晰的商品细节视图。下面将详细介绍这个插件的使用及其涉及到的IT知识点。
我们要理解PHPWeb是一个基于PHP开发的内容管理系统,它提供了丰富的模块化功能,方便用户构建和管理网站。而“产品模块”是PHPWeb系统中用于展示和管理商品信息的核心组件,可能包括商品列表、详情页、购物车等特性。
放大镜插件的实现主要基于JavaScript和CSS技术。JavaScript,尤其是jQuery库,通常被用来处理用户的交互事件,如鼠标移动和点击。当用户将鼠标悬停在图片上时,JavaScript会捕获这个事件,并显示一个放大的图像区域。CSS则用于样式控制,包括放大镜的形状、透明度、位置等视觉效果。
该插件可能还利用了HTML5的`<canvas>`元素或者纯CSS3的`transform`属性来实现图片放大。`<canvas>`元素可以动态绘制图形,通过JavaScript读取图片像素并放大显示;而CSS3的`transform`属性则可以对元素进行缩放变换,实现无损放大效果。
在实际应用中,为了提高用户体验,放大镜功能可能还集成了 lazy loading 技术。这意味着只有当用户将鼠标移动到图片附近时,才会加载放大镜所需的高分辨率图像,减少页面加载时间和带宽消耗。
此外,考虑到SEO(搜索引擎优化)的需求,此插件可能还需要确保在没有JavaScript的情况下,产品图片仍然能够正常显示。这就需要HTML结构的合理性,以及可能的图片alt属性,以便搜索引擎理解和索引图片内容。
文件“phpweb产品模块产品放大镜功能tcy”可能是该插件的配置文件、示例代码或者使用教程。根据文件名推测,"tcy"可能是开发者的缩写或者版本标识。具体使用方法可能包含如何在PHPWeb后台启用插件、如何配置插件参数、如何自定义样式等步骤。
phpWeb产品模块的放大镜插件是结合了PHP、JavaScript、CSS、HTML5和SEO策略的前端技术实现,旨在为用户提供更直观的产品浏览体验。正确理解和应用这些技术,可以有效地提升网站的用户友好性和商业价值。